Output 50bf808f8a6e164b72c052b4d621d05a9ac15d4ce58b862a817484fe940077e3:2

value
551331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 667b62aef4443d3be10d0fd70741e8924a5c618f OP_EQUAL
address
3B2tf5pz8WmDLR9j86BRX9YvXPeTtm9Yi7
transaction
50bf808f8a6e164b72c052b4d621d05a9ac15d4ce58b862a817484fe940077e3
spent
true